Output e36490f8ef9da328913f31eb161b95f1c71faf49684edb6fae427b32fc52084e:0

value
103000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22548feab75fd846d278419379194c952ac7424a OP_EQUAL
address
34pYCYnr2fchqcuot6EAQKiqiAfSUEZdMJ
transaction
e36490f8ef9da328913f31eb161b95f1c71faf49684edb6fae427b32fc52084e
confirmations
269040
spent
true